This policy describes how QB Analyzer, an internal application operated by Patten Studio ("the Studio"), handles data. QB Analyzer is used only by the Studio, on the Studio's own accounting records. It has no external users, no public sign-up, and no customer accounts.
01

Scope of this policy

QB Analyzer is a private, internal tool. It connects to the Studio's own QuickBooks Online company file and to internal systems the Studio operates. It is never connected to books belonging to clients, customers, or any other organization.

The only QuickBooks company the Software connects to is the Studio's own. No third-party company data is accessed, processed, or stored at any time.

02

Information the Software accesses

When authorized, the Software reads the Studio's business accounting records through the Intuit QuickBooks Online API. This may include:

  • Company profile, chart of accounts, tax codes, and preferences.
  • Customer, vendor, employee, and item records, including names, addresses, email addresses, and phone numbers held in those records.
  • Transactions, including invoices, bills, payments, deposits, purchases, and journal entries.
  • Documents attached to transactions, such as receipts and bills.
  • Financial reports, such as trial balance, general ledger, profit and loss, and balance sheet.

Some of these records contain personal information about individuals the Studio does business with. That information is handled as confidential business data under this policy.

The Software also stores authentication credentials issued by Intuit, including access and refresh tokens and the company identifier (realm ID).

03

How the information is used

The Studio uses this information only to:

  • Produce internal reports and analysis of the Studio's own financial position and activity.
  • Create and maintain an archive of the Studio's accounting records for legal and tax record-keeping.
  • Verify that the Studio's records are complete and accurate.

The information is not used for marketing, advertising, profiling, analytics about individuals, resale, or training machine learning models.

04

Access to QuickBooks data is read-only

The Software reads from QuickBooks Online. It does not create, modify, void, or delete records in QuickBooks.

05

Where information is stored

Extracted records and attachments are stored on computers, storage, and internal systems controlled by the Studio. Data is not stored on servers operated by the developer of the Software as a service, and is not transmitted to any hosted analytics, logging, or monitoring service.

07

Security

The Studio protects this information by:

  • Transmitting all data over encrypted connections (TLS).
  • Storing API credentials and tokens outside of source control, with access restricted to authorized personnel.
  • Encrypting stored archives and restricting access to devices and accounts controlled by the Studio.
  • Limiting access to employees and contractors who need it for their work.
  • Revoking credentials promptly when a person's access is no longer required.

No method of transmission or storage is completely secure, and the Studio cannot guarantee absolute security.

08

Retention and deletion

Accounting archives are retained for as long as the Studio is required to keep financial records under applicable tax and corporate law, and for as long as they remain useful for legitimate business purposes. Authentication tokens are retained only while the connection is in use and are deleted once it is revoked.

An individual whose personal information appears in the Studio's accounting records may contact the Studio at the address below to ask about that information. Requests for deletion are honored to the extent the Studio is not required by law to retain the record.
